Duster84 Posted December 15, 2015 Posted December 15, 2015 greets. running the above mods in windowed mode and the gamma is too low - can't see a single thing in the dungeons! even with a torch. so using MO but can't seem to change any of the internal graphics. any changes made to skyrimperfs.ini inside of MO don't take effect in the game. they also get reverted to some default settings. ie: change gamma to 1.0 in MO using ini editor. run game. game dark. exit out. view ini file, gamma setting back to 0.6!!! not sure what is goin on here, anyone know? anyone give any tips/tricks to make gamma higher using windowed mode?? ty
LaEspada Posted December 15, 2015 Posted December 15, 2015 When you have onetweak it forces the game to run in windowed mode, and you can't tweak gamma (brightness) in windowed mode. Either edit the ini that comes with onetweak to disable windowed mode and make sure you settings have full-screen mode on and you can tweak your gamma.
